Tear Fluid Interleukin Biomarkers and Intraocular Pressure Response After Micropulse Transscleral Cyclophotocoagulation, Conventional Cyclophotocoagulation, and Antiglaucoma Surgery in Patients With Glaucoma

SUMMARY

This prospective study aims to evaluate inflammatory biomarkers in tear fluid in patients with glaucoma undergoing micropulse transscleral cyclophotocoagulation (MP-CPC), continuous-wave cyclophotocoagulation (CPC), and antiglaucoma surgeries. The study will assess the concentrations of pro- and anti-inflammatory interleukins in tear samples collected before treatment, 5-7 days after the procedure, and 1 month postoperatively. Intraocular pressure (IOP) will be measured at the same time points. The correlation between changes in interleukin levels and IOP reduction will be analyzed. Additionally, the study aims to compare inflammatory response patterns among the MP-CPC, CPC, and surgical treatment groups and to identify interleukin profiles associated with a clinically significant hypotensive effect.

Treatments
Experimental: MicroPulse Transscleral Cyclophotocoagulation Group
Participants in this group will undergo MicroPulse transscleral cyclophotocoagulation for the treatment of glaucoma. Tear samples and intraocular pressure measurements will be collected before treatment, 5-7 days after the procedure, and 1 month postoperatively to evaluate inflammatory biomarker changes and treatment response.
Active_comparator: Conventional Transscleral Cyclophotocoagulation Group
Participants in this group will undergo conventional continuous-wave transscleral cyclophotocoagulation for the treatment of glaucoma. Tear samples and intraocular pressure measurements will be collected before treatment, 5-7 days after the procedure, and 1 month postoperatively to evaluate inflammatory biomarker changes and treatment response.
Active_comparator: Antiglaucoma Surgery Group
Participants in this group will undergo incisional antiglaucoma surgery for the treatment of glaucoma. Tear samples and intraocular pressure measurements will be collected before surgery, 5-7 days after surgery, and 1 month postoperatively to evaluate inflammatory biomarker changes and treatment response.
